William W. Powers State Recreation Area

Nestled directly within Chicago’s city limits, William W. Powers State Recreation Area offers a convenient and expansive natural retreat for families. This recreational spot boasts a massive natural lake, Wolf Lake, which is a haven for fishing enthusiasts of all ages. Beyond angling, families can enjoy boating on the calm waters, spotting a variety of migratory birds, and picnicking amidst the scenic surroundings. The park also features accessible hiking trails that are perfect for a leisurely stroll with children, allowing them to connect with nature without venturing far from home. It’s an urban oasis providing a genuine outdoor experience.

Kankakee River State Park

Just a short drive south of Chicago, Kankakee River State Park offers a sprawling 4,000-acre natural playground along 11 miles of the Kankakee River. This park is an adventurer’s delight, perfect for families who love to explore. Engage in year-round outdoor sporting and recreation, from hiking and biking on extensive trails to fishing and kayaking on the river. Horse stables are also available, making it a unique destination for equestrian families. The scenic riverside trails provide stunning views and opportunities for wildlife spotting, while designated picnic areas offer perfect spots for a family meal amidst nature.

Starved Rock State Park

Starved Rock State Park is an Illinois icon, famed for its stunning canyons, seasonal waterfalls, and miles of picturesque hiking trails, making it an ideal destination for adventurous families. While a bit further from Chicago, the spectacular natural beauty makes the drive worthwhile. Children will be captivated by the towering sandstone bluffs and intricate geological formations. The park offers diverse trails suitable for various skill levels, ensuring that even younger explorers can participate. A historic lodge provides dining options and accommodations, offering a comfortable base for extended visits. It’s a true natural wonder for all ages to discover. [0]

Matthiessen State Park

Often visited in conjunction with Starved Rock, Matthiessen State Park offers an equally captivating, yet perhaps less crowded, experience for families. This large forest park and canyon features remarkable prairie land, serene springs, and an abundance of wildlife. Families can explore trails that wind through canyons, woods, and unique limestone formations, creating a sense of discovery around every corner. Picnic areas are scattered throughout the park, ideal for a peaceful family lunch. The varied terrain and natural beauty provide an excellent setting for children to learn about geology and local ecosystems in an engaging outdoor environment. [1]

Adeline Jay Geo-Karis Illinois Beach State Park

For families dreaming of a beach getaway combined with a state park adventure, Adeline Jay Geo-Karis Illinois Beach State Park is the only remaining beach ridge shoreline in Illinois, offering unique natural scenery. This expansive 4,160-acre park boasts diverse scenery and abundant wildlife along the shores of Lake Michigan. Families can enjoy swimming and building sandcastles on the secluded beach, picnicking with lake views, and exploring trails that wind through sand dunes and various ecosystems. It’s an exceptional spot for bird watching, fishing, and camping, providing a refreshing coastal experience distinct from the inland parks. [4]
